Is There Caffeine in Bloom Drinks? Decoding Your Favorite Bloom Products

4 min read

According to Bloom Nutrition's product information, caffeine content varies significantly across its product line, with some beverages containing as much as 225mg per serving, while others have only negligible, trace amounts. Understanding which Bloom drinks contain stimulants is crucial for managing your daily intake and achieving specific wellness goals.

A Product-by-Product Look at Bloom's Caffeine Content

Bloom Nutrition's reputation is built on a diverse range of wellness products, but this variety means that the caffeine levels differ dramatically. While some products are designed to deliver a powerful energy boost, others are formulated as caffeine-free or nearly so, catering to different lifestyle needs. It is essential to check the specific product label to know exactly what you are consuming.

High Energy Pre-Workout: The Caffeinated Powerhouse

For those seeking a significant stimulant kick, Bloom's High Energy Pre-Workout is explicitly designed for that purpose. This product provides a substantial dose of caffeine, derived from green tea extract, to enhance focus, energy, and endurance during workouts.

  • Significant Caffeine Dose: A single serving of the pre-workout contains approximately 225mg of natural caffeine. This is a potent amount, roughly equivalent to 2-3 standard cups of coffee. It is intended for pre-exercise consumption to maximize physical and mental performance.
  • Synergistic Ingredients: Beyond caffeine, this formula also includes other performance-enhancing ingredients like L-Theanine, which works to mitigate the jitters often associated with high caffeine intake, and beta-alanine to help with muscular endurance.
  • Intended Use: This product is not designed for casual, everyday consumption but for targeted use before intense physical activity.

Sparkling Energy Drink: Natural Energy on the Go

Bloom's Sparkling Energy Drink line is another product explicitly formulated to contain caffeine. This is an alternative to traditional, sugary energy drinks, providing a clean boost without the extra calories.

  • Moderate Caffeine Level: Each 12oz can contains 180mg of natural caffeine, sourced from green coffee bean and green tea extracts. This is a strong dose suitable for an afternoon pick-me-up or a pre-workout boost, falling between a standard coffee and the higher concentration in Bloom's Pre-Workout.
  • Added Wellness Benefits: These sparkling beverages also include other functional ingredients, such as prebiotics for gut health and ginseng for mental focus.
  • Flavor Variety: The drinks come in a range of fruity flavors, offering a palatable and refreshing way to consume caffeine.

Greens & Superfoods: Negligible Caffeine Content

For those looking to avoid stimulants, the popular Bloom Greens & Superfoods powder is the ideal choice. While trace amounts of caffeine may be present due to the use of some natural ingredients, like matcha green tea leaf, the overall amount is negligible and not intended to provide an energy effect.

  • Source of Trace Caffeine: Certain flavors, particularly those containing matcha, will have a minimal, undetectable amount of naturally occurring caffeine. However, this is not the product's primary function and will not cause a stimulatory effect.
  • Focus on Wellness: The primary goal of the Greens & Superfoods product is to support digestion, reduce bloating, and provide a range of vitamins and minerals. The energy boost reported by users comes from improved overall nutrition rather than a direct stimulant effect.
  • Caffeine-Free Versions: Some versions of the super greens are explicitly marketed as non-caffeinated to cater to those with sensitivities or who prefer to avoid it entirely.

Comparison of Bloom's Caffeinated and Non-Caffeinated Drinks

Feature Sparkling Energy Drink High Energy Pre-Workout Greens & Superfoods Powder
Caffeine Content 180mg per can 220-225mg per serving Negligible, trace amounts
Caffeine Source Green coffee bean extract, green tea extract Green tea leaf extract Matcha green tea leaf (trace amount)
Primary Function Clean energy boost, metabolism support Boost endurance, focus, and performance Digestive support, reduce bloating, nutrient intake
Format Ready-to-drink cans, powder sticks Powder Powder, stick packs, gummies
Best for Afternoon energy boost, sugar-free alternative Pre-exercise performance enhancement Daily wellness, overall digestion
